*STYLISH CHARMER in GAGE PARK COMMUNITY* Welcome home to the perfect balance of a contemporary aesthetic with timeless character! This 3 BED 3 BATH 2,610 Total SqFt house exudes pride of ownership - offering a bright, open-flow layout designed for comfortable daily living and effortless entertaining. The heart of the home is the chef-inspired kitchen, featuring crisp white cabinetry, elegant quartz countertops, and a large central island that seamlessly transitions into the classy dining area and cozy living room. Two spacious bright bedrooms on the Main level, with a convenient 4-PC hallway bathroom between them. The Upper level reveals a sprawling, versatile, open-concept Primary bedroom loft space including a 4-PC Ensuite bathroom. The fabulous fully finished Basement is a great rec space for a Kids Playroom and Media Centre - it also includes a bonus area for a Home Gym or Office, separate Laundry station with deep wash sink, and handy 2-PC powder room. (NOTE: Some photos have been virtually staged.) Surrounded by historic charm, this downtown community exudes class and character. Across the street is the iconic century-old McHugh Public School + Brampton Memorial Arena is home to the Excelsiors Lacrosse, and the Curling Club & Baseball Fields are just steps away! Discover Gage Park with its summer fun splash pad and playground, magical winter skating trail & fabulous holiday festivals. Explore boutique Shops & Dining, experience Culture at the Rose Theatre, PAMA Gallery & Museum, and City Hall centre. Enjoy leisure Golfing at Lionhead, Turnberry & Peel Village courses. Queen & Main intersection allows access to Major Highways 410/407/401 and seamless commuting with Brampton GO Train & Bus Station makes life easy. Combining peaceful living and urban accessibility, this property offers an opportunity to join one of Brampton's most established and sought-after communities!
